Lalit Memorial kicks off today

A total of 13 teams will participate in the league-cum-knockout tournament organised in the memory of former Anfa acting president and Three Star president Lalit Krishna Shrestha.
Youth teams from the 12 ‘A’ Division clubs and four National League outfits will be competing in the tournament that offers a cash purse of Rs 300,000 to the eventual champions.
The runners-up will get Rs 150,000, while each team were provided with a preparation amount of Rs 100,000. The best individuals—striker, midfielder, defender, goalkeeper and coach—will also get Rs 10,000 apiece. The teams have been divided in four groups with the top two making it to the quarter-finals.
Group ‘A’ consists of Jhapa XI, Nepal Armed Police Force Club, Saraswoti Youth Club and Chyasal Youth Club. Tribhuvan Army Club (TAC), Friends Club, Manang Marshyangdi Club and Farwest FC are in Group ‘B’ with Group ‘C’ pitting Lumbini FC, Jawalakhel Youth Club, Himalayan Sherpa Club and New Road Team.
Sankata, Nepal Police Club, Brigade Boys Club and Morang FC are in Group ‘D’. Jhapa will take on newly promoted Chyasal in the tournament opener. TAC will take on Farwest in the second game.
